Pro Display Heads to Hall 1 at ISE 2016

prodisplay-0116Interactive mirrors, transparent LCD screens, and anti-glare treatments are the new faces on Pro Display’s stand at ISE 2016. With important updates to flagship display technologies such as Digital Glass, Mirrorvision and SunScreen, visitors can get up close and personal with the products in Hall 1 (stand M6) at ISE 2016.

ISE 2016 sees British screen manufacturer Pro Display return to the RAI Amsterdam, this time with a larger booth in Hall 1. The company will showcase its next-generation optical projection screens, multi-touch technologies, and innovative screen solutions such as interactive mirrors, transparent LCD screens and anti-glare treatments for new and existing displays.

Pro Display will exhibit in Hall 1, stand M6, from 9-12 January 2016, at the newly extended four-day show at RAI Amsterdam in the Netherlands.

In the last 12 months Pro Display has noted a number of key trends in the market: a rise in demand for large-format projection screens; a dramatic increase in the use of ultra-short throw projection; and continued strong interest in interactive touch solutions. In response to this demand, Pro Display has enhanced flagship products in its range such as Digital Glass and SunScreen, whilst introducing a number of complementary new offerings.

Pro Display’s large projection screens lend themselves perfectly to ultra-HD formats, having effectively infinite resolution at normal viewing distances thanks to the micro-diffusion characteristics of the latest optical surfaces. The only limiting factor is the projection hardware, and projectors can already be tiled to create resolutions beyond 4K. Projection also offers significant cost savings over LCD or LED panels, especially at sizes over a 90″ diagonal.

Ultra-short throw is forecast to be the fastest growing sector in projector sales to 2020, according to research by Marketwatch.com. Pro Display launched its new ultra-short throw screen technologies for rear projection (Digital Glass) and front projection (SunScreen) at ISE 2015 last year, and is now extremely well positioned to serve this growing market over the coming years.

Finally, interactive touch solutions are being specified in new installations, and also as a retrofit solution to extend the life of existing non-touch display screens. People increasingly expect to interact with the images they see, and Pro Display’s intouch division exists to meet that expectation.
